A single certain of the critical deficiencies identified from disreputable or uneducated assistance is a failure to appropriately inform clients what will come about to their assets if they sign a Protected Trust Deed Scotland Appropriate right here are the details if you private considerable assets (such as equity in your house, or a automobile truly worth additional than £3000 for illustration) they will “vest” in your Trustee. As adequately as your month-to-month contributions, you’ll require to have to learn a way to pay out over the value of such assets or face up to the prospect of them currently being sold.
Presently currently being the owner of an asset such as a automobile or a house does not propose that you can not or necessarily ought to not sign a Trust Deed. What it does propose is that you ought to comprehend, in advance, especially what your duty will be and have a viable tactic in thoughts to complete that duty. If you don’t totally comprehend your asset responsibilities, or can not envisage a way to pay out over the value of an asset that you are not prepared to relinquish, don’t sign a Trust Deed.
A lot of men and women also learn that they aren’t informed in advance about what will come about if issues take a turn for the far greater or worse. What will come about if your pay out raises over the rate that your fees do (for illustration a promotion, or a bonus)? The solution is that you’ll have to pay out over some or all of the additional funds. What will come about if you come into a lump sum (perhaps from an inheritance)? You will be necessary to pay out the funds into your Protected Trust Deed. What transpires if your revenue is decreased or your fees boost? If the sum you can pay out minimizes there is a prospect that your Trust Deed might be extended or even cancelled based mostly on the conditions (even even though the Trustee has some discretion and will generally not want to penalise a client for occasions that had been out of their manage).
